summaryrefslogtreecommitdiff
path: root/kvm-all.c
diff options
context:
space:
mode:
authorAlexander Graf <agraf@suse.de>2014-01-27 15:18:09 +0100
committerPaolo Bonzini <pbonzini@redhat.com>2014-02-21 11:19:34 +0100
commit521f438e36b0265d66862e9cd35e4db82686ca9f (patch)
tree09934f974aef9eed87552883eec20cc5fb03ad92 /kvm-all.c
parent7c08db30e6a43f7083a881eb07bfbc878e001e08 (diff)
downloadqemu-521f438e36b0265d66862e9cd35e4db82686ca9f.tar.gz
KVM: Use return value for error print
Commit 94ccff13 introduced a more verbose failure message and retry operations on KVM VM creation. However, it ended up using a variable for its failure message that hasn't been initialized yet. Fix it to use the value it meant to set. Cc: qemu-stable@nongnu.org Signed-off-by: Alexander Graf <agraf@suse.de>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>
Diffstat (limited to 'kvm-all.c')
-rw-r--r--kvm-all.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/kvm-all.c b/kvm-all.c
index f742f8dc24..979a8d952f 100644
--- a/kvm-all.c
+++ b/kvm-all.c
@@ -1427,7 +1427,7 @@ int kvm_init(void)
} while (ret == -EINTR);
if (ret < 0) {
- fprintf(stderr, "ioctl(KVM_CREATE_VM) failed: %d %s\n", -s->vmfd,
+ fprintf(stderr, "ioctl(KVM_CREATE_VM) failed: %d %s\n", -ret,
strerror(-ret));
#ifdef TARGET_S390X